Senior Software Engineer

World's leading integrated customer communications and intelligence platform for growing businesses, trusted by over 20,000 companies worldwide.
Backend
Senior Software Engineer
Remote
501 - 1,000 Employees
7+ years of experience
Enterprise SaaS

Description For Senior Software Engineer

Aircall, a leading customer communications platform trusted by 20,000+ companies worldwide, is seeking a Senior Software Engineer to join their Authentication team in EMEA. This role offers an exciting opportunity to work with cutting-edge technologies in a remote environment, focusing on authentication and authorization systems using SAML, SSO, OAuth 2.0, and GraphQL.

The position involves working with serverless architecture on AWS, developing business-critical features that directly impact customer value. As a Senior Engineer, you'll be responsible for design, development, and deployment of robust solutions, while maintaining high standards of operational excellence. The role requires expertise in NodeJS and TypeScript, with a strong focus on security, scalability, and performance.

The ideal candidate will have 7+ years of backend development experience and extensive AWS knowledge. You'll be part of a global team of 600+ professionals across nine offices, contributing to a product that transforms how businesses connect with their customers. The company culture emphasizes customer obsession, continuous learning, and delivering extraordinary outcomes.

Benefits include a competitive salary package, comprehensive health coverage, lunch and commute benefits, and a strong focus on work-life balance. Aircall provides a unique work environment that values diversity, equity, and inclusion, with 45+ nationalities represented in their workforce. This is an excellent opportunity for someone who enjoys solving meaningful problems and wants to be part of a fast-growing B2B startup that's making a significant impact in the business communications space.

Last updated 7 days ago

Responsibilities For Senior Software Engineer

  • Design, develop, deploy, and operate business-critical features
  • Write clean scalable code using Typescript/Node.js
  • Analyze requirements and design solutions
  • Optimize product and platform performance
  • Mentor junior team members
  • Participate in on-call rotation
  • Ensure operational excellence and metrics monitoring

Requirements For Senior Software Engineer

TypeScript
Node.js
  • 7+ years experience in back-end development using TypeScript & NodeJS
  • Extensive experience with AWS in production environment
  • Knowledge of code quality and engineering best practices
  • Experience with Clean Code, Clean Architecture, TDD, BDD, and CI/CD
  • Effective communication and collaboration skills
  • Experience with Domain Driven Design (plus)

Benefits For Senior Software Engineer

Medical Insurance
  • Competitive salary package
  • Health coverage
  • Lunch benefits
  • Commute benefits
  • Sports benefits
  • Work-life balance focus
  • Fast-learning environment
  • Multi-cultural workplace with 45+ nationalities

Interested in this job?

Jobs Related To Aircall Senior Software Engineer

Senior Software Engineer

Senior Software Engineer position at Aircall, focusing on backend development with TypeScript/Node.js and AWS, building authentication systems for a leading customer communications platform.

Senior Software Engineer - Core Entities team - Paris based

Senior Software Engineer position at Aircall, working on core platform services in Paris

Senior Software Engineer - Core Entities team

Senior Software Engineer position at Aircall in Madrid, focusing on backend development with Ruby and TypeScript, requiring 5+ years of experience and AWS expertise.

Senior Software Engineer Backend/AI

Senior Backend & AI Engineer position at Aircall, focusing on developing AI-powered features for customer communications platform, requiring 5+ years of backend experience and strong AI expertise.

Software Engineer (Backend), Growth

Senior Backend Software Engineer position at Aircall, focusing on growth engineering and scalable solutions for customer communications platform. 7+ years experience required, hybrid work in San Francisco.